Since the Federal Police’s Tempus Veritatis operation was launched, the public messaging groups analyzed by Palver have presented intense political debate. Between sharing news and comments about the operation, mentions of Jair Bolsonaro (PL) reached, on February 8, the highest level in the last 30 days.

In groups of supporters of the former president, videos and messages began to circulate threatening the Judiciary.

In messages sent in public WhatsApp groups, users challenged minister Alexandre de Moraes (STF) to arrest Bolsonaro.

In one of the messages, accompanied by a video that contains excerpts from a speech by former federal deputy Deltan Dallagnol (Novo), there is mention of a possible civil war and incitement to violence. Mentions of the term “CIVIL WAR” more than tripled on February 8 compared to previous days.

Since February 8, discussions have remained heated, but without a central theme directing the debate.

From February 12th, a video of the former president calling on his supporters to take part in the event on Avenida Paulista began circulating in groups. Since then, there has been a massive distribution of content on the topic in public messaging groups, and the issue has gained prominence in both opposition groups and groups supporting the former president.

A TikTok video, tagged with the account @renata_patriota, which appeared in the group sample for the first time on February 15, confirmed the presence of former President of the United States Donald Trump and President of Argentina Javier Milei at the event called by Bolsonaro.

Despite a report published by Sheet pointing out the unfeasibility of illustrious presences, similar content intensifies in the following days, always accompanied by a call for the event.

On Sunday, February 18, messages began to be distributed denying the international presence.

The text, aimed at patriots, said that the rumors were created by the left to frustrate the expectations of the former president’s supporters, and that, upon noticing the famous absences, they would have the feeling of Bolsonaro’s discredit.

Last Saturday (24), however, a live broadcast produced on YouTube and shared in groups confirmed that Trump and Milei would be present on Avenida Paulista. Other messages that circulated on the same day included the presence of Elon Musk and Netanyahu among those confirmed.

One of the strategies used in network communication is to use topics that are in evidence to benefit from the popularity of the topic.

In this sense, in the same week that opposition parliamentarians filed a request for impeachment against President Lula (PT) due to the comparison between Israel’s actions in Gaza and the Holocaust, the messages related to the call for the act were adapted to the context .

After Bolsonaro’s initial video asking protesters not to carry banners or posters, there was intense communication about the instructions, including the request to wear green and yellow.

Since the 21st, however, messages have asked protesters to also carry the Israeli flag, as a way of showing support for the Jews. This adaptation, in addition to taking advantage of the theme’s prominence, aimed to create antagonism with Lula, inflating Bolsonaro’s political base.

On Saturday night (24), messages and videos circulated in groups of Bolsonaro supporters pointing out the presence of infiltrators in Paulista.

In the video with a denunciatory tone, the infiltrators would be responsible for placing posters and signs with messages attacking the STF and ministers Alexandre de Moraes and Flávio Dino. The messages also accused the infiltrators of wanting to promote chaos and confusion during the act.

The feeling of fear also prevailed in messages that sought to link the escape of prisoners from the federal penitentiary in Mossoró (RN) with the existence of a larger plan to attack Bolsonaro.

Other users shared information that hundreds of thousands of Army soldiers were on standby to carry out arrests during the act, including that of the former president.

Another fear raised was the possibility of confrontation with organized fans, who would be infiltrated. These fears were assuaged in messages that highlighted that the São Paulo Military Police force had been reinforced to protect the protesters.
